Olayinka Akinpelu
House of Assembly aspirant in Ogun State, Honourable Sulaimon Mujaidu Ajibola, has expressed profound appreciation to party leaders, stakeholders and ward executives across Obafemi Owode Local Government for their support and encouragement towards his political aspiration.
Ajibola, in a statement issued after a series of consultations and stakeholder engagements, particularly appreciated the Apex Leadership of Obafemi Owode Local Government led by Engr Akeem Babatunde Adesina, for what he described as unwavering guidance, encouragement and confidence reposed in his ambition to represent the people at the Ogun State House of Assembly.
The aspirant also specially acknowledged Rt Honourable Tunji Egbetokun and Honourable Adesina Ogunsola for their support, leadership and commitment to strengthening unity among party stakeholders across the local government.
According to Ajibola, the support and solidarity demonstrated by party leaders and grassroots mobilisers have further reinforced his commitment to service, inclusiveness and sustainable development within the constituency.
He further extended appreciation to all the twelve ward chairmen in Obafemi Owode Local Government under the leadership of Mathew Sopade, describing their collective backing and mobilisation as a strong reflection of unity, loyalty and confidence in his aspiration.
Ajibola noted that the decision of representatives from the twelve wards to accompany him during consultations with apex leaders symbolised the strength of grassroots participation and the shared desire for progress within the local government.

The House of Assembly hopeful equally recognised the contributions of notable stakeholders present during the meetings, including Adesina Nureni Ayinde, Foluke Funmilayo Oluwadare, Ganiyat Oyelakin, Adekunle Anifowose and Emabinu Taofeek, commending their efforts in mobilising support and fostering cooperation among party faithful.
He stated that the encouragement received from party executives and stakeholders across the wards reflected his long-standing relationship with the grassroots as well as his commitment to party development over the years.
Ajibola added that remarks made by stakeholders during the consultations, particularly those centred on his loyalty, humility, accessibility and dedication to service, would continue to inspire him towards responsible representation if entrusted with the mandate.
While thanking all members and leaders who attended the consultations and meetings, the aspirant assured residents and party faithful that their support would not be taken for granted.
He pledged to continue engaging stakeholders across the constituency in pursuit of collective development and inclusive governance.
Ajibola also promised the people of Obafemi Owode Local Government better dividends of democracy through effective representation, people-oriented legislation and sustained grassroots development if elected into office.
